PHILADELPHIA CO. v. SECURITIES & EXCHANGE COM'N

No. 9513.

164 F.2d 889 (1947)

PHILADELPHIA CO. v. SECURITIES & EXCHANGE COMMISSION.

United States Court of Appeals District of Columbia.

Decided October 8, 1947.

Writ of Certiorari Denied February 2, 1948.
